== Observations ==
*Tree, 7-16 m tall, branches velvety. *Leaves oblong to obovate, 13-25 cm × 5-9.5 cm, hairy, 3-nerved from base. *Flowers yellow-green, 5-merous. *Fruit a pyriform drupe, ca. 3 cm × 1.5 cm, yellow, velvety. In evergreen forests at altitudes up to 300 m. In Thailand fruiting in May-August.
